Joss Whedon wants 'Firefly' revival


Recommended Posts

Joss Whedon has admitted that he would still "love" to revive Firefly.

The cult sci-fi drama was axed by Fox after just 14 episodes, but was later revived by Avengers director Whedon for 2005 film Serenity.

"It's something I would love to do," Whedon told the Toronto Sun of a second Firefly movie.

"Part of me is like, 'God, it would be great when I finish Avengers 2 to do [a sequel]'."

The writer/director said that he would "never really accept" that Firefly is over for good.

"I always, in the back of my head, think, 'What if I could get the old gang back together?'," he admitted.

Firefly star Sean Maher - who played Simon Tam - recently voiced his support for a sequel to Serenity.

"A television show would be very tricky with all of our availability, and I don't think that's in the realm of possibility," Maher said in November. "But what about another movie?"
